&lt;p&gt;The 2026 NFL Draft and its immediate aftermath dominated the week, capped off by the arrival of the rookie class and the official start of minicamp. First-round running back Jadarian Price is already generating massive hype across the fanbase, drawing bold comparisons to a pre-injury Nick Chubb while taking his first practice handoffs at the VMAC.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;General Manager John Schneider and the front office officially wrapped up the 2026 NFL Draft, masterfully maneuvering the board to turn just two picks into five on the final day. Schneider noted the team relies heavily on a &amp;ldquo;competitor scale&amp;rdquo; to evaluate prospects&amp;rsquo; self-efficacy, actively avoiding rookies who would be awestruck by established veterans.&lt;/p&gt;</description></item></channel></rss>
